Document Description
The proposed project is an application for a Specific Plan Amendment (SPA), Major Use Permit (MUP) and Reclamation Plan (RP) for the Otay Hills Aggregate Mining and Inert Debris Landfill Project. THe project is located within six parcels (APNs 648-050-13, 14; 648-080-13, 14, 25; and, 648-040-39, 40 that total approximately 434 acres. The MUP project area consists of 110 acres upon which the mining of contruction aggregates, materials processing, and inert debris landfill operations will occur. The balance of the 434-acre area would be placed in biological open space. Primary access to the site would be from the east end of Calzada De La Fuente which connects to Alta Road one-half mile north of Otay Mesa Road.
